The Beta Three (B3) U15a is a 15-inch, two-way full-range active plastic loudspeaker designed for both portable and permanent sound reinforcement. While the full "service manual" containing internal board repair details is typically restricted to authorized service centers, comprehensive technical specifications and circuit schematics for its amplifier module are available for maintenance and troubleshooting. Technical Specifications & Performance System Type: 15" Two-way full-range active speaker with built-in bi-amp module. Power Output: 400W RMS total, divided as 300W for the woofer (LF) and 100W for the tweeter (HF). Frequency Response: 40Hz – 18kHz (-3dB). Maximum SPL: 114dB continuous / 120dB peak at 1m. Amplifier Class: Class H. Transducers: LF: 1 x 15" woofer with a 50mm (2") voice coil. HF: 1 x 1.7" diaphragm compression driver. Dispersion: 50°–100° x 55° (H x V) via a rotatable horn for flexible vertical or horizontal orientation. Technical Specifications at a Glance Before diving into repairs, it is critical to understand the internal architecture of the U15a. This model is a 15-inch, two-way, full-range active speaker designed with a polypropylene injection-molded cabinet. Transducers : Features a 15" high-power low-frequency (LF) transducer with a 50mm voice coil and a 1.7" diaphragm compression driver for high frequencies (HF). Power Output : The built-in Bi-amp power amplifier module delivers a rated power of 300W LF and 100W HF (RMS) . Acoustics : Frequency response ranges from 40Hz to 18kHz (-3dB) with a maximum peak SPL of 120dB at 1 meter. Dispersion : Utilizes a rotatable horn with a controlled coverage pattern of 50°–100° x 55° , making it versatile for both Front of House (FOH) and stage monitor use. 2. Maintenance and Troubleshooting Service manuals typically provide schematics and procedures for addressing common issues. For the Beta 3 U Series, focus on these key areas: Power and Circuitry Voltage Selection : Ensure the voltage selector is correctly set to your local standard ( 110V/220V ) before powering on to prevent blowing the internal protection fuse. Fuse Replacement : If the unit fails to power on, check the 14A protection fuse . Always replace it with a fuse of the exact same amp rating as specified in the U15a User Manual . Amplifier Protection : The built-in Class H or Class D modules (depending on the specific production run) include clip indicators.
